A member asked:

I have complete numbness and stiff 1st finger and thumb on r. hand. did a thyroid panel t4 was 9.7 t3 (liothyronine) 27.3 and hs-ths was 2.36. is this normal?

Probably: It appears that your total t3 (liothyronine) is low but your total T4 and TSH are normal. This may simply be a lab error or from sick euthyroid sydrome (caused by an elevation of reverse t3 (liothyronine) during illness). Hashimoto's thyroiditis is associated with carpel tunnel syndrome which is probably why your labs were checked. However, you need anti-TPO antibodies to diagnose.
